π Primary Responsibilities
-
Lead and coordinate multi-disciplinary design teams, including Architecture, Civil, Structural, Mechanical, Electrical, Plumbing (MEP), Security, Fire Protection, ICT, and Building Management/Energy Performance Management Systems (BMS/EPMS).
-
Manage all project phases, encompassing site due diligence, campus planning, conceptual design, schematic design, detailed design, and the preparation of construction documentation.
-
Ensure the timely delivery of high-quality design deliverables that precisely meet client specifications and stringent project timelines.
-
Proactively identify potential project risks, developing and implementing innovative and practical mitigation strategies.
-
Support Project Managers and Project Directors in commercial and contractual governance, ensuring adherence to compliance standards and effective risk management.
-
Present design proposals, project updates, and technical solutions to clients and stakeholders with clarity and professionalism.
-
Foster seamless collaboration between design teams and local/international delivery teams to ensure design localization and permitting compliance.
-
Respond promptly and effectively to client inquiries and evolving project requirements.
